About

Sari Tuomisto is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Infectious Diseases and Epidemiology. According to data from OpenAlex, Sari Tuomisto has authored 18 papers receiving a total of 411 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 7 papers in Molecular Biology, 5 papers in Infectious Diseases and 5 papers in Epidemiology. Recurrent topics in Sari Tuomisto's work include Streptococcal Infections and Treatments (4 papers), Gut microbiota and health (4 papers) and Oral microbiology and periodontitis research (3 papers). Sari Tuomisto is often cited by papers focused on Streptococcal Infections and Treatments (4 papers), Gut microbiota and health (4 papers) and Oral microbiology and periodontitis research (3 papers). Sari Tuomisto collaborates with scholars based in Finland, United States and Russia. Sari Tuomisto's co-authors include Pekka J. Karhunen, Tanja Pessi, Janne Aittoniemi, Risto Vuento, Pekka Collin, Mika Martiskainen, Terho Lehtimäki, Heini Huhtala, Ashley Hall and Gulnaz T. Javan and has published in prestigious journals such as PLoS ONE, Journal of Vascular Surgery and Age and Ageing.
